#01431e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#01431e is composed of 0.4% red, 26.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.2%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 146.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 13.3%. #01431e color hex could be obtained by blending #02863c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#01431e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000904 is the darkest color, while #f5fff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#01431e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#202422 is the less saturated color, while #01431e is the most saturated one.
